summaryrefslogtreecommitdiffstats
path: root/src/gui/painting
Commit message (Expand)AuthorAgeFilesLines
* Merge remote-tracking branch 'origin/5.9' into devLiang Qi2017-06-191-1/+7
|\
| * Translate the adjusted deviceWindowRect with an adjusted offsetAllan Sandfeld Jensen2017-06-071-1/+7
* | Merge "Merge remote-tracking branch 'origin/5.9' into dev" into refs/staging/devLiang Qi2017-06-071-1/+1
|\ \
| * | Merge remote-tracking branch 'origin/5.9' into devLiang Qi2017-06-071-1/+1
| |\|
| | * Fix semi-opaque linear gradient on ARGB32Allan Sandfeld Jensen2017-06-011-1/+1
* | | Implement remaining porter-duff compositions for rgb64Allan Sandfeld Jensen2017-06-072-19/+784
|/ /
* | Merge "Merge remote-tracking branch 'origin/5.9' into dev" into refs/staging/devLiang Qi2017-05-302-37/+62
|\ \
| * | Merge remote-tracking branch 'origin/5.9' into devLiang Qi2017-05-292-37/+62
| |\|
| | * Merge remote-tracking branch 'origin/5.9.0' into 5.9Liang Qi2017-05-191-37/+29
| | |\
| | | * Revert gamma-corrected handling of transparent destination bufferAllan Sandfeld Jensen2017-05-081-37/+29
| | * | Fix painterpath rect intersections with points on the rectAllan Sandfeld Jensen2017-05-171-0/+33
| | |/
* | / Claim alpha8 is premultipliedAllan Sandfeld Jensen2017-05-291-1/+1
|/ /
* | Add QPolygon::intersects() methodsAllan Sandfeld Jensen2017-05-182-0/+47
* | Simplify code by factoring out brush transformation for gradientsEirik Aavitsland2017-05-151-51/+33
* | Merge remote-tracking branch 'origin/5.9' into devLiang Qi2017-05-073-94/+73
|\|
| * Handle implicit close in QDashedStrokeProcessorAllan Sandfeld Jensen2017-05-021-1/+10
| * Cleanup rgb32 text-blending code pathAllan Sandfeld Jensen2017-05-021-92/+57
| * Fix return of empty paths with multiple points on intersectionsAllan Sandfeld Jensen2017-04-281-1/+6
* | Docs: Fix some warningsFriedemann Kleint2017-04-211-2/+2
* | xcb: Add experimental legacy support for native X11 paintingLouai Al-Khanji2017-04-212-3/+3
* | Merge remote-tracking branch 'origin/5.9' into devLiang Qi2017-04-207-45/+41
|\|
| * Move Q_REQUIRED_RESULT to its correct positionThiago Macieira2017-04-206-40/+40
| * qgrayraster: use a cast to void to mark a variable as unusedGiuseppe D'Angelo2017-04-201-5/+1
* | Use qToStringViewIgnoringNull() where applicableMarc Mutz2017-04-191-2/+2
* | Merge remote-tracking branch 'origin/5.9' into devLiang Qi2017-04-075-35/+43
|\|
| * Merge remote-tracking branch 'origin/5.8' into 5.9Liang Qi2017-04-065-34/+42
| |\
| | * Copy stretch to multifont fontDefAllan Sandfeld Jensen2017-04-051-0/+2
| | * GCC 7: fix -Werror=implicit-fallthroughGiuseppe D'Angelo2017-04-044-34/+40
* | | Merge remote-tracking branch 'origin/5.9' into devLiang Qi2017-04-043-21/+22
|\| |
| * | Merge remote-tracking branch 'origin/5.8' into 5.9Liang Qi2017-03-283-21/+22
| |\|
| | * Fix generation of gradient shader function in PDFTobias Koenig2017-03-281-1/+2
| | * Annotate more implicit fallthroughsAllan Sandfeld Jensen2017-03-272-20/+20
* | | QColor: port to QStringViewMarc Mutz2017-03-292-6/+43
* | | Improve PDF/A-1b support in QPdfWriterTobias Koenig2017-03-289-26/+347
* | | Fix clipping of graphics effects in high dpi modeDaniel Teske2017-03-282-6/+23
* | | Merge remote-tracking branch 'origin/5.9' into devLiang Qi2017-03-203-14/+8
|\| |
| * | Merge "Merge remote-tracking branch 'origin/5.8' into 5.9" into refs/staging/5.9Liang Qi2017-03-132-1/+7
| |\ \
| | * | Merge remote-tracking branch 'origin/5.8' into 5.9Liang Qi2017-03-132-1/+7
| | |\|
| | | * Add -Wfloat-equal to Qt's header clean checkThiago Macieira2017-03-071-0/+6
| | | * Fix documentation typosChristian Gagneraud2017-02-251-1/+1
| * | | Clean-up QRgba64 constructorsAllan Sandfeld Jensen2017-03-131-13/+1
| |/ /
* | | Split fetchTransformedBilinear and fetchTransformedBilinear64Allan Sandfeld Jensen2017-03-191-356/+289
* | | Merge remote-tracking branch 'origin/5.9' into devLiang Qi2017-03-144-36/+473
|\| |
| * | Avoid QRgba64 arrays in the generic text-rendering routinesAllan Sandfeld Jensen2017-03-081-8/+8
| * | Gui: Replace LGPL21 with LGPL license headerKai Koehne2017-03-032-28/+40
| * | Add AVX2 optimized bilinear texture transformAllan Sandfeld Jensen2017-02-282-0/+425
* | | Merge remote-tracking branch 'origin/5.9' into devLiang Qi2017-03-022-6/+6
|\| |
| * | QtGui: kill some unneeded relocationsMarc Mutz2017-02-242-6/+6
* | | Merge remote-tracking branch 'origin/5.9' into devLiang Qi2017-02-282-3/+3
|\| |
| * | Fix wrong access to qMemRotateFunctionsAllan Sandfeld Jensen2017-02-221-2/+2